What Is a Hob?

A hob, frequently referred to as a cooktop or stove top, is the flat surface on which pots and pans are put for cooking. Hobs are equipped with heating components that produce the required heat for cooking food. They are available in numerous types, consisting of gas, electric, induction, and ceramic choices. Each type uses unique advantages and downsides.

Types of Hobs

  • Gas Hobs:

    • Heat Source: Natural gas or lp.
    • Advantages: Instant heat control and responsiveness, preferred by numerous chefs for Hobs Uk precise cooking.
    • Disadvantages: Requires a gas connection and can be less energy-efficient.
  • Electric Hobs:

    • Heat Source: Electric coils or smooth glass-ceramic surfaces.
    • Advantages: Generally easier to clean, even heating, and extensively readily available.
    • Drawbacks: Slower to warm up and cool down compared to gas.
  • Induction Hobs:

    • Heat Source: Electromagnetic currents.
    • Benefits: Quick heating, energy-efficient, and only heats up the cookware, not the surrounding surface.
    • Drawbacks: Requires suitable pots and pans (ferrous materials).
  • Ceramic Hobs:

    • Heat Source: Electric and has a smooth glass surface.
    • Advantages: Sleek appearance, simple to tidy, and even heating.
    • Drawbacks: Can take longer to warm up and cool down.

Types of Ovens

  • Standard Ovens:

    • Heat Source: Electric or gas.
    • Benefits: Good for standard baking and roasting.
    • Disadvantages: Can have unequal heat distribution.
  • Convection Ovens:

    • Heat Source: Electric or gas with a fan for circulating air.
    • Benefits: More even cooking and faster cooking times due to airflow.
    • Disadvantages: Can be pricier and may need adjustments in cooking times.
  • Microwave Ovens:

    • Heat Source: Microwaves.
    • Benefits: Quick cooking and reheating; excellent for defrosting.
    • Downsides: Can not brown or crisp food well.
  • Steam Ovens:

    • Heat Source: Steam generation.
    • Advantages: Retains nutrients and moisture in food, much healthier cooking choice.
    • Disadvantages: Longer cooking times and generally greater expense.

FAQs About Hobs and Ovens

1. What is the very best type of hob for a newbie cook?

Answer: A ceramic or electric hob is frequently suggested for beginners due to relieve of use and cleaning.

2. Can I use any pots and pans on an induction hob?

Response: No, induction hobs require pots and pans made from magnetic materials (e.g., cast iron or stainless-steel).

3. How often should I clean my oven?

Answer: It is advisable to clean your oven every couple of months, or more frequently if you use it typically.

4. Is it better to bake in a convection oven?

Answer: Yes, convection ovens are typically better for baking as they offer even heat distribution. However, some fragile recipes may benefit from conventional ovens.
